Abstract

The invention discloses a steel plate hoisting hook. A front hole and a rear hole are formed in the front end and the rear end of a positioning middle beam respectively; a front hoisting rope and a rear hoisting rope penetrate through the front hole and the rear hole respectively; limiting stopping blocks are fixed in the middles of the hoisting ropes respectively; hoisting hooks are movably mounted on the two sides of the front hoisting rope and the rear hoisting rope respectively; rope slings are arranged at the tail ends of the front hoisting rope and the rear hoisting rope respectively. According to the invention, the front hoisting hooks and the rear hoisting hooks are distributed symmetrically at intervals; the front hoisting rope and the rear hoisting rope are restrained to apply pulling force inward in the direction parallel to a steel plate, so as to enable the hoisting hooks to be pressed and buckled on the edges at symmetrical positions of the steel plate tightly; when the steel plate is hoisted, the steel plate is ensured to be in anterior-posterior balance without inclination and side skidding; the steel plate hoisting hook is very simple in structure, easy to manufacture, simple to operate, high in hoisting efficiency and safety, and very favorable for popularization and application.

Description

Hanger for hoisting steel plate
Technical field:
The present invention relates to hoisting steel plate mobile technology field is and in particular to a kind of hanger for hoisting steel plate.
Background technology:
In field of machining, steel plate belongs to roomy and thin workpiece, is difficult by hoisting transportation, especially monolithic steel Plate, lifting is cumbersome.Use when carrying steel plate in Workshop at present is the combination that suspension hook adds steel wire rope mostly;So Lifting mode safety coefficient low, troublesome poeration;In order to adapt to the needs of different-thickness varying number steel plate transport, existing steel plate The suspension hook bayonet socket width of suspender is very big, and after lifting, stress point mostly is suspension hook inner side edge(Referring to label in Fig. 2 12 position), suspension hook with It is only locking relation between steel plate, this locking relation easily slides, and leads to hoisting process steel plate crank, is susceptible to take off Fall accident, abnormally dangerous.In fact, most of improved technology is all to increase accessory, such as Publication No. to suspension hook By an elastic compression part is increased to suspension hook bayonet socket, steel plate is pressed in the utility model patent of CN101503165U Tightly, because lifting steel plate at least needs four suspension hooks, troublesome poeration, torsion spring pressure is limited, once there is centre-of gravity shift, only relies on Torsion spring effect is difficult to prevent steel plate from gliding, and the torsion spring of too big torsion is also unfavorable for manually operating.Another part improved technology exists The utility model patent of baroque problem, such as Publication No. CN203199874U, disclose a kind of with bracing frame and The hoisting structure of flexible claw, this hoisting structure is firstly the need of a suspension bracket mating with steel plate size, this suspension bracket weight Greatly, the steel plate typically no less than being lifted, its complex structure, manufacturing cost is high, and maintenance difficulties are big, are unfavorable for promotion and implementation.
Content of the invention:
The present invention seeks to there is positioning for existing hoisting steel plate instrument being forbidden, easily slip, and complex structure etc. Problem, provides a kind of structure simply and stability is very good, safe and efficient hanger for hoisting steel plate.
Technical scheme:A kind of hanger for hoisting steel plate, including a positioning central sill fitting in the middle part of upper surface of steel plate, in positioning The rear and front end of central sill is respectively arranged with front hole and metapore, runs through front lifting rope and rear lifting rope respectively in front hole and metapore, every Lifting rope be fixedly arranged in the middle of positive stop, the lifting rope length of positive stop side is slightly larger than opposite side lifting rope length, after making lifting Steel plate and the center of gravity of spacing central sill be slightly partial to limited location block side;The activity respectively of the both sides of described front lifting rope and rear lifting rope Suspension hook is installed, the end of front lifting rope and rear lifting rope is each provided with rope sling.Each suspension hook is arranged on corresponding lifting rope by connector, This connector includes outer shaft and interior axle, and suspension hook is hinged on outer shaft, and wirerope-winding is in interior axle.Described interior axle is provided with Pulley, wirerope-winding is on pulley.The described positioning front hole at central sill two ends and the intrinsic wear-resistant pad of metapore inner sleeve or be set with cunning Wheel.
Beneficial effects of the present invention:1st, the spacing central sill described in the present invention can be always positioned at steel plate medium position, limit Position central sill can keep forward and backward suspension hook symmetrically spaced apart, after steel plate is lifted, steel plate anterior-posterior balance can be kept not tilt Do not break away.
2nd, spacing central sill can not only keep before and after's suspension hook symmetrically spaced apart, and can constrain forward and backward lifting rope and make it Along inwardly applying pulling force parallel to steel plate direction, so that the tightly inside clinching of each suspension hook is at steel plate symmetric position edge, by steel Plate tightly pins to tilt and does not break away.
3rd, in the present invention, positive stop is respectively provided with to forward and backward steel wire rope, thus after steel plate is lifted, spacing central sill Slightly offset to one side with steel plate center of gravity, such that it is able to prevent spacing central sill to be lifted a backward Slideslip, be limit using deadweight Position central sill is still within the middle part of steel plate such that it is able to keep the steel plate left-right balance being lifted.
4th, present configuration is very simple, easy to manufacture, simple to operate, lifts efficiency high, high safety, is especially advantageous for pushing away Wide enforcement.

Specific embodiment:
Embodiment:A kind of hanger for hoisting steel plate, referring to Fig. 1, spacing central sill fits in steel plate 14 upper surface middle part position, in front and back Symmetrically, symmetrical.Hole 2 and metapore 3, front lifting rope 4 and 5 points of rear lifting rope before the rear and front end of positioning central sill 1 is respectively arranged with Not through in front hole 2 and metapore 3.The both sides of front lifting rope 4 and rear lifting rope 5 are movably installed with suspension hook 7 respectively, front lifting rope 4 and after The end of lifting rope 5 is each provided with rope sling 6.Each suspension hook 7 is arranged on corresponding lifting rope by connector 8, and this connector 8 includes outer shaft 9 and interior axle 10, suspension hook 7 is hinged on outer shaft 9, and wirerope-winding is in interior axle 10.Furthermore it is also possible to be provided with interior axle 10 Pulley, wirerope-winding is on pulley.The front hole 2 at described positioning central sill 1 two ends and the intrinsic wear-resistant pad of metapore 3 inner sleeve.
Spacing central sill may insure front lifting rope 4 and rear lifting rope 5 and each suspension hook 7 to be all located at steel plate 14 front and rear sides symmetrical On position.Spacing central sill can also constrain forward and backward lifting rope 5 and make it along inwardly applying pulling force parallel to steel plate 14 direction, can from Fig. 2 To find out, the stressed wire rope connecting with suspension hook 7 is almost parallel with steel plate 14, so that the tightly inside clinching of each suspension hook 7 is in steel Plate 14 symmetric position edge, actual loading position is mainly the base 13 of suspension hook 7, and suspension hook inner side edge 12 only has safety effect (After lifting in known technology, stress point mostly is suspension hook inner side edge 12), no matter how suspension hook 7 bayonet socket width changes, and does not affect two The fixed performance of side suspension hook 7, steel plate 14 is tightly pinned to tilt and does not break away.
Every lifting rope be fixedly arranged in the middle of positive stop 11, the lifting rope length of positive stop 11 side is hung slightly larger than opposite side Rope length degree makes the steel plate 14 after lifting and the center of gravity of spacing central sill slightly be partial to limited location block 11 side;Can from Fig. 2 Go out, length a is slightly less than length b, center of gravity is slightly partial to b side, such that it is able to prevent spacing central sill to be lifted a backward Slideslip, It is that spacing central sill is still within steel plate 14 middle part such that it is able to keep steel plate 14 left-right balance being lifted using deadweight.
